Abstract:
With the increasing popularity and adoption
of IoT technology, fog computing has been used as an
advancement to cloud computing. Although trust
management issues in cloud have been addressed,
there are still very few studies in a fog area. Trust is
needed for collaborating among fog nodes and trust
can further improve the reliability by assisting in
selecting the fog nodes to collaborate. To address
this issue, we present a provenance based trust
mechanism that traces the behavior of the process
among fog nodes. Our approach adopts the
completion rate and failure rate as the process
provenance in trust scores of computing workload,
especially obvious measures of trustworthiness.
Simulation results demonstrate that the proposed
system can effectively be used for collaboration in a
fog environment.